Purpose : The Medical Transcriptionist transcribes, edits and enters records dictated by providers into the EMR. The Medical Transcriptionist should have a high-understanding of medical terminology and understanding of the Book of Style Medical Transcription standards. The reports will include but not limited to: History and Physicials, Consultations, Operative Reports and Progress Notes.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Listen to the recorded dictation of the provider and transcribe a completed medical report. Translate medical abbreviations into appropriate form. Ensure that Book of Style standards for Transcription are met. Follow patient confidentiality guidelines and legal documentation requirements. Conduct QA of finished transcribed reports from the vendor. This includes listening to the entire recording and making the appropriate corrections, querying the provider when necessary. Monitor daily dictation of Operative Reports, History and Physical, Progress Notes, Consults, etc. and transcribe the reports. Work closely with medical records staff to ensure timely transcription of patient medical records, which include notification of STAT requests. Enter completed reports into the EMR. Use a variety of research methods for correct spelling, terminology of medical procedures, supplies, etc. Maintain an accuracy of 98%-99% quality standard Qualifications
